I've installed Mendeley Desktop on 64bit Ubuntu 9.04 and cannot get some basic features working. Most immediately, when I make some annotations on a PDF file and choose to export PDF with annotations, I am allowed to choose the output file name, accept the choice, and then nothing happens. No error notice and no exported file created.

Has anyone else got this behaviour? Anyone else having more luck?

Sorry about this, I've managed to confirm that this is indeed a problem, and it appears isolated to our Debian and Ubuntu packages. I've filed a bug for this on our internal bug tracker and we'll look into fixing it as soon as possible.

You can try heading to http://www.mendeley.com/download-mendeley-desktop/ and using the "generic" linux package as this seems to work fine for exporting with annotations.

the newest update (9.4.1) fixed it for me. Note that mendeley does not say 9.4.1 in the about, but rather 9.4. To know that you have 9.4.1, do apt-cache policy mendeleydesktop
